the FTF Advisory Board decided in 2009 to make its first awards to support research travel for postgraduates focusing on French-Australian relations. Two students, Amie Sexton and Fabrice Dauchez, benefited from these grants. Presentations will take place at the inaugural Awards and Fundraising Dinner to be held at University House on 2 December 2009.
